Description

9-α-Ribofuranosyladenine is a specialized nucleoside analog of significant interest in biochemical and pharmaceutical research. This compound serves as a crucial building block and reference standard in the development of novel therapeutic agents and diagnostic tools. It is primarily utilized by research institutions and pharmaceutical companies engaged in antiviral, anticancer, and metabolic pathway studies.

Application

  • Pharmaceutical Research & Development: As a key intermediate or reference standard in the synthesis of novel nucleoside-based drugs targeting viral infections and cancer.
  • Biochemical Studies: For investigating enzyme mechanisms, particularly those involving adenosine deaminase and other nucleoside-modifying enzymes.
  • Antiviral Agent Development: Exploration of its potential and its derivatives as inhibitors of viral replication.
  • Metabolic Pathway Analysis: Used as a tracer or probe in studies of purine metabolism and nucleotide salvage pathways.
  • Academic Research: Serves as a critical reagent in university and institutional labs for fundamental studies in medicinal chemistry and molecular biology.
  • Diagnostic Kit Manufacturing: Potential use as a component in enzymatic assay kits for clinical diagnostics.

Basic Information

Product Name 9-α-Ribofuranosyladenine
CAS No. 5682-25-7
Molecular Formula C₁₀H₁₃N₅O₄
Molecular Weight 267.24 g/mol
Synonyms 9-α-D-Ribofuranosyladenine; 9-α-Adenosine; 9-α-D-Adenosine; 9-α-Adenosine; Adenosine, 9-α-D-ribofuranosyl-; 9-α-Ribofuranosyladenine; 9α-Adenosine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ed in a dry environment to prevent degradation. For long-term storage, consider desiccated conditions.

Specification

Item Specification
Appearance White to off-white powder
Identification (IR) Conforms to structure
Identification (HPLC) Retention time matches reference standard
Purity (HPLC) ≥ 98.0%
Water Content (KF) ≤ 2.0%
Residue on Ignition ≤ 0.5%
